Architect Duties & Responsibilities

The role and function of an Architect includes the following duties and responsibilities:

  • Architects consult with other professionals about the design of an environment;
  • Preparing and presenting feasibility reports and design proposals to the client;
  • Advising the client on the practicality of their project;
  • Using IT in design and project management, specifically using computer-aided design software;
  • Architects keep within financial budgets and deadlines;
  • Discussing the objectives, requirements and budget of a project;
  • Ensuring that the environmental impact of the project is managed.
  • Architects prepare applications for planning and building control departments;
  • Negotiating with contractors and other professionals;project managing and helping to coordinate the work of contractors;
  • Architects control a project from start to finish;
  • Preparing tender documents for contracts;
  • Architects specify the nature and quality of materials required;
  • Producing detailed workings, drawings and specifications;
  • Resolving problems and issues that arise during construction;
  • Architects prepare tender applications and presentations;
  • Regular site visits to check on progress, ensuring that the project is running on time and to budget;

Note that this is not an exhaustive list of Architect duties and responsibilities. Job functions for specific Architect roles may vary, depending on the industry and type of employer.
